Hello everyone, new member here, just made a switch from EVGA x99 classified to ASUS x99 strix, first ever asus board and unfortunately the switch has not been so pleasant... I had my evga x99 classy for 4-5 months with out a single hiccup and after I installed strix all hell broke loose... blue screens on cold boot, some timesii have to hit power button several times before pc actually boots, but I will be making a separate thread for that...

My concern at the moment is VRM running very hot, no overclocks, stock everything on idle VRM sits at 55-60c, when I boot a game it goes over 60, my evga board used to idle at 35c and around 40 while gaming... But here's what I noticed, on x99 strix not all components are covered by a heatsink, see pics below...

i have x99 deluxe ii*
my vrm temps reached 61degrees with oc at 4.2ghz
i then swapped rad fans to intake air above mobo. now vrm temps at max load maxed out at 55degrees oc 4.2ghz
